The tools for changing a wheel are lo-
cated in the luggage compartment
under the carpets. When storing the
tools, ensure the jack is correctly
clipped in, with base plate B towards
the bottom.
The tools included in the tool kit depend
on the vehicle.
Nothing should be placed
on the floor area in front of
the driver as such objects
may slide under the pedal
during braking manoeuvres, thus
obstructing its use.

Jack 1
Fold it and position retainer A correctly
before refitting it in its housing.
Lever 2
This tightens or releases the tow eye 3.
Tow eye 3

Hubcap tool 4
This tool is used to remove the wheel
trims.

Wheelbrace 5
Allows the wheel bolts to be locked/un-
locked.
Wheel locking nut
Storage compartments are provided in
the support to house these.
Do not leave the tools un-
secured inside the vehicle
as they may come loose
under braking. After use,
check that all the tools are correctly
clipped into the tool kit, then posi-
tion it correctly in its housing: risk of
injury.
If wheel bolts are supplied in the
tool kit, only use these bolts for the
emergency spare wheel: refer to the
label affixed to the emergency spare
wheel.
The jack is designed for wheel
changing purposes only. Under no
circumstances should it be used for
carrying out repairs underneath the
vehicle or to gain access to the un-
derside of the vehicle.
